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Bark louse | Claras echymipera |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Arthropoda (Arthropods)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Insecta (Insects)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Psocodea (Psocodea) | Peramelemorphia (Peramelemorphia) |
| Family | Elipsocidae | Peramelidae |
| Genus | Elipsocus | Echymipera |
| Species | Elipsocus pumilis | Echymipera clara |
